Please all of you, do not take the flu or pneumonia lightly. Pneumonia almost took my son when he was 3 yrs old (14 years ago) and it just took my sister-in-law. My 80-yr old aunt should be released from the hospital very soon. My parents and I all have the flu now (we did not get the shot). My wife and son are not sick (they got the shot). I have strain A, which the shot works on, and am on the mend thanks to Tamiflu. Still trying to get the fluid out of my lungs, but pulled a muscle in my gut from coughing fits, so I am working hard not to cough. I appreciate all your kind words for Kelly. She was a very giving person. and the room where the words were said overflowed into an additional room in order to accommodate all the friends and family that attended, A life well lived, even if it was too short (56 years). Nine out of every hundred deaths in the USA right now are from flu of flu-related pneumonia.
